The highly anticipated list of North America's 50 best bars was revealed during a live awards ceremony in San Miguel de Allende, Mexico this week.
The annual ranking of the continent's top watering holes and cocktail creators includes bars in the U.S., Canada, Mexico and the Caribbean. Mexico came away with a whopping 15 honorees, including the number one bar in North America in Mexico City's Handshake Speakeasy. Mexico's capital city produced nine of the country's 15 award winners.
"Handshake Speakeasy continues to push the boundaries of the art of cocktail creation as well as always putting service first, so we are pleased to see them crowned the first bar in Mexico City named number one on North America's 50 Best Bars list," Emma Sleight, Head of Content for North America's 50 Best Bars, said in a statement. "We also extend our congratulations to all the other incredible bars on this year’s list that are testament to how exciting, innovative and dynamic the North American bar scene truly is."
New York City was another big winner in 2024, boasting a dozen of the 26 U.S. bars ranked in the top 50, including Superbueno (second), Overstory (third), Martiny's (fourth) and Double Chicken Please (seventh), which all made the top 10.
Martiny’s in Manhattan's Union Square neighborhood jumped 25 spots to earn the Nikka Highest Climber Award.
In the Caribbean, La Factoría in San Juan, Puerto Rico ranked 18th while Grand Cayman's Library by the Sea joined the list as a new entry at number 35. The latter also won the London Essence Best New Opening Award.
Canada also secured multiple entries, including Toronto's Civil Liberties (21st), which was named The Best Bar in Canada for the third straight year. Other ranked bars north of the border include Vancouver's Botanist Bar (24th), Toronto's Bar Pompette (29th), Montreal's Cloakroom (39th) and The Keefer Bar (49th) in Vancouver.
Special award winners for 2024 included Simpl Things in Toronto (Campari One To Watch), a bar outside of the main list that the 50 Best team believes can rank in the future. Meanwhile, Meadowlark (32nd) in Chicago received the Siete Misterios Best Cocktail Menu Award and True Laurel in San Francisco earned the title of Ketel One Sustainable Bar for its commitment to sustainability.
Claudia Cabrera of Mexico City's Kaito del Valle (28th) received the accolade of Roku Industry Icon, New Orleans' Jewel of the South (seventh) was named The Best Bar in South USA, Los Angeles' Thunderbolt (eighth) was named The Best Bar in West USA and Chicago's Kumiko (19th) was named The Best Bar in Midwest USA.
See below for a complete breakdown of this year's rankings:
- Handshake Speakeasy, Mexico City
- Superbueno, New York
- Overstory, New York
- Martiny's, New York
- Rayo, Mexico City
- Jewel of the South, New Orleans
- Double Chicken Please, New York
- Thunderbolt, Los Angeles
- Licorería Limantour, Mexico City
- Tlecān, Mexico City
- Zapote Bar, Playa del Carmen
- Katana Kitten, New York
- Café La Trova, Miami
- El Gallo Altanero, Guadalajara
- Employees Only, New York
- Aruba Day Drink, Tijuana
- Café de Nadie, Mexico City
- La Factoría, San Juan
- Kumiko, Chicago
- Dante, New York
- Civil Liberties, Toronto
- Service Bar, Washington D.C.
- Allegory, Washington D.C.
- Botanist Bar, Vancouver
- Herbs & Rye, Las Vegas
- Baltra Bar, Mexico City
- Bekeb, San Miguel de Allende
- Kaito del Valle, Mexico City
- Bar Pompette, Toronto
- True Laurel, San Francisco
- Attaboy, New York
- Meadowlark, Chicago
- The Dead Rabbit, New York
- Selva, Oaxaca
- Library by the Sea, Grand Cayman
- Century Grand, Phoenix
- Arca, Tulum
- Pacific Cocktail Heaven, San Francisco
- Cloakroom, Montreal
- Bar Mordecai, Toronto
- Maison Premiere, New York
- Hanky Panky, Mexico City
- Angel's Share, New York
- Milady's, New York
- Brujas, Mexico City
- Mírate, Los Angeles
- Cure, New Orleans
- Best Intentions, Chicago
- The Keefer Bar, Vancouver
- Atwater Cocktail Club, Montreal
